Transaction 32c96c9819e922cc0257bc91da18c6053f7fbb1ccaf624d1d638cae1a7038cf8
1 Input
1 Output
-
32c96c9819e922cc0257bc91da18c6053f7fbb1ccaf624d1d638cae1a7038cf8:0
- value
- 422673
- script pubkey
- OP_0 OP_PUSHBYTES_20 18ece4c24ee1d3b1dc98be3f04abfd6d39b984df
- address
- bc1qrrkwfsjwu8fmrhychclsf2lad5umnpxl9uknqf